Dudhani village is situated in Teshil Fatehpur, District Jamtara and in State of JHARKHAND India. Village has population of 403 as per census data of 2011, in which male population is 200 and female population is 203. Total geographical area of Dudhani village is 106 Hectares. Population density of Dudhani is 4 persons per Hectares. Total number of house hold in village is 87.

Sex Ratio of Dudhani Village -Census 2011
As per the Census Data 2011 there are 1015 Femals per 1000 males out of 403 total population of village. There are 1550 girls per 1000 boys under 6 years of age in the village.
Literacy of Dudhani Village
Out of total poplation total 253 people in Dudhani Village are literate, among them 147 are male and 106 are female in the village. Total literacy rate of of Dudhani is 71.88%, for male literacy is 81.67% and for female literacy rate is 61.63%.
